HOLLYWOOD, CA — (03-21-24) — ‘The Acolyte’ Television Series Official Trailer has been released starring Carrie-Ann Moss (The Matrix) and Dafne Keen, in the upcoming American science fiction television series created by Leslye Headland for the streaming service Disney+.
The Acolyte is part of the $66 billion Star Wars franchise, that is set at the end of the Star Wars franchise’s High Republic era, approximately 100 years before Star Wars: Episode I – The Phantom Menace (1999). The story follows a respected Jedi Master investigating a series of crimes that bring him into conflict with a former Padawan learner and reveals sinister forces at work in the Old Republic.
Season One of The Acolyte also stars Amandla Stenberg, Lee Jung-Jae, Manny Jacinto and Rebecca Henderson. The Eight Episodes of the new Sci-Fi series is scheduled to premiere with Two Episode back to back on Disney+ June 4, 2024. The other six episodes will be released weekly.
